WARNING!

Risk of explosion and chemical burns!

Improper handling of batteries poses the risk of explosions or chemical burns caused by 

leaking battery acid.

• 

Only replace the battery with equivalent battery types.

• 

Non-rechargeable batteries are not to be recharged, do not disassemble them, do not 

dispose of them in fire and do not short circuit them.

• 

Do not expose the battery to intense heat like sunshine or fire. Risk of leakage!

• 

When inserting the battery, make sure that the polarity (+/–) is correct.

• 

Immediately remove an empty battery from the alarm clock.

• 

Do not allow battery acid to come into contact with skin, eyes, or mucous membranes. 

• 

In the event of contact with battery acid, rinse the affected areas immediately with 

plenty of water and, if you experience an unexpected reaction, see a doctor immedia

-

tely.

• 

Avoid overheating the alarm clock and consequently the inserted battery.

• 

If the battery in the clock has leaked, also clean the battery contacts.

NOTICE!

  

Risk of damage!

If you use the alarm clock improperly or water penetrates the housing, the alarm clock or the 

battery may be damaged.

•  Protect the alarm clock from exposure to dirt and dust, extreme heat and sunlight.

• 

Keep the alarm clock away from open flames (e.g. candles). 

• 

Do not drop the alarm clock, do not expose it to shocks and impacts do not position any 

objects on the alarm clock and do not apply pressure to the alarm clock otherwise the 

glass may break.

• 

Do not bin any sharp or pointed objecst in contact with the glass to avoid damage.

•  Never immerse the alarm clock in water.

•  Make sure that no water penetrates the housing.

NOTICE!

 

Please make sure that your alarm clock is not permanently subjected to humidity and 

please avoid conditions such as dust, heat or prolonged solar radiation. The alarm clock is 

protected against impacts that may occur during normal use. However, very strong mag

-

netic fields (e.g. from electric welding devices, transformers, etc.) must be avoided in any 

case, sin they may cause deviations in time measurement.

Initial use

Inserting the battery

Open the battery compartment 

5

 on the rear of the alarm clock 

1

 and insert the bat-

tery, ensuring the correct polarity. Start with the plus pole. Before inserting the battery we 

recommend to place the ribbon under the battery so that you can remove it more easily.
